Join Outdoor Nevada host John Burke as he explores the historic Marlette Lake Water System in Nevada — an extraordinary 19th-century engineering achievement with a nearly mile-long tunnel, built to supply water to the booming mining town of Virginia City. Discover how this ambitious project powered the Comstock Lode and continues to play a role in Nevada’s water infrastructure today.
